The Hanoi Stock Exchange (HNX) has just issued a decision to suspend trading for 29 stocks listed on UPCoM, effective from December 15, 2023.
These stock codes include: AVF, B82, BT6, C12, CTA, CTN, FBA, GTT, HDO, HLA, HVG, KAC, KHL, KSS, NDF, NTB, PID, PX1, S27, S96, SD1, SD8, SDB, SDX, STL, TBT, TNM, V15, VNI.
A number of stocks on UPCoM have had their trading suspended. |
According to HNX, the basis for considering suspending stock trading is that the listed companies have not published their audited annual financial statements for three consecutive fiscal years or more. This is a serious violation of the obligation to disclose financial statements by listed companies on the UPCoM market.
Previously, these businesses had been restricted from trading due to late submission of required financial reports and a lack of corrective measures.
Based on the regulations on registration and management of unlisted securities transactions issued with Decision No. 34/QD-HDTV dated November 16, 2022, of the Board of Members of the Vietnam Stock Exchange, and in accordance with the guidance of the Vietnam Stock Exchange, to protect the rights of investors, the Hanoi Stock Exchange has handled violations within its authority.
Shares will be considered for removal from the trading suspension list when the listed company submits a written request accompanied by documents proving that it has fully rectified the cause of the trading suspension.
